Cardinal Nation ranks prospects in July
Trevor Condon fills in @ 12 and Tegan Kuhns @ 13 with Rocco at 23. Top 11 remain the same:
Rainiel Rodriguez Spr 1
Liam Doyle Spr LHS 2
Joshua Baez Mem OF 3
Jimmy Crooks StL C 4
Quinn Mathews Mem LHS 5
Tanner Franklin Peo RHS 6
Leonardo Bernal Mem 7
Cooper Hjerpe Spr LHS 8
Jurrangelo Cijntje Mem 9
Brandon Clarke Spr IL 10
Tekoah Roby Mem IL 11

Post Draft...and my apologies for my Andrew Williamson bias, but I believe he'll be a starting major league corner outfielder, so I'll stick with my rankingJDW wrote: ↑27 Jul 2026 13:45 pmSo I'd rather see your top ten rankings, and I'd assume I'm not alone with that thought.craviduce wrote: ↑27 Jul 2026 13:40 pm when fan vote commences this fall on TCN, I hope everyone, or most everyone, puts Franklin 2nd. And Includes Odle, Kuhns and Condon in the Top 8. And if Doyle somehow manages to slip to 6th, I will not grimace once at an obscure reliever landing in the TCN fan vote Top 15![]()
1. Rainiel Rodriguez, catcher
2. Tanner Franklin, RHP
3. Yhoiker Fajardo, RHP
4. Joshua Baez, OF
5. Trevor Condon, CF
6. Quinn Mathews, LHP
7. Tegan Kuhns, RHP
8. Liam Doyle, LHP
9. Jacob Odle, RHP
10. Andrew Williamson, OF
11. Brandon Clarke, LHP
12. Tai Peete, CF
13. Tekoah Roby, RHP (I wanted him in my Top 10, I think he'll get back there, unless his body is just completely broken with too many injuries. He's a GREAT, talented RHP who's probably ready for the Majors, if he can regain that pre-TJ form from 2025
14. Leo Bernal, catcher....I like him, but we're so stacked, that he falls to 14...other years, he's a Top 10 prospect, but again, we're so stacked up top right now
15. Cooper Hjerpe, LHP...he could be ready to move up the lists if he continues his recent performances
just missed... Mason Molina LHP, Yairo Padilla SS, Sebastian Dos Santos SS, Rocco Maniscalso SS, Jesus Baez SS/3B, Jurrangelo Cijntje RHP/LHP, Emmanuel Luna CF
